  5. OPEC will almost certainly cut production. Production here in Alberta will have some reduction at this price level, and a lot at $40.00. Even in recession the price elasticity of demand in US can be expected to be high in this neighbourhood. Although China's demand is expected to be relatively flat it is still expected to be a rise, same for India. BTW I don't think $100M worth of hi-jacked oil will affect the price. I agree, OPEC will cut production, that's a given. Venuzuela will follow too... As for the hijacked tanker, it's more than the oil it is holding right now, it's the disruption to the supply chain. The 2 million barrels will not find its way to its destination, the schedule of thanker is disrupted, which "forces" Saudi Arabia to cut production due to "lack of storage facilities". Somebody has to throttle back a refinery because the oil didn't arrive and rework the forecast production schedule because future tanker shipments will be cut... all of it adds up to non-delivery of projected oil shipments.... And a tanker is just a "toke of appreciation" fired across the bow... pun intended.... God help us if a major refinery is next.....   21. "One of every 1,000 skydivers will die while jumping"... like any other phrase it is riddled with opportunities for interpretation. Consider the case when you are wearing a parachute on the way to altitude and the airplane experiences a malfunction resulting in 100% fatality of the occupants.... Question is: will the accident result in a skydiving fatality or a General Aviation (GA) fatality ... I also agree that skydiving statistics and probabilities are two different matters. If a skydiver chooses "higer degrees of risk" such as swooping, inadeaquate safety procedures, poorly maintained gear (including aircraft), then the odds of a fatal outcomen are higher for that particular skydiver. It creates a predictability factor but has minimal bearing on the odds of any other skydiver (unless they share the same traits). To put in contrast, the CDC published an study that 6.6 children in 1,000 are affected by autism... You will have to dig through the data to figure out the madness of the statement.
